Engenheiro de Software Sênior – Billing Core & Integrações de Pagamento
Descrição da vaga:
Sobre a vaga
Você é apaixonado(a) por resolver problemas complexos e quer atuar no coração de uma plataforma de billing robusta e escalável? Estamos buscando uma pessoa com perfil técnico forte em Arquitetura de Software para trabalhar diretamente no core da plataforma Killbill (Java) e nos plugins personalizados (Node.js/TypeScript) que integram nosso sistema ao hub de pagamentos e a todo o ecossistema financeiro. Sua experiência será crucial para sustentar o crescimento do nosso negócio de e-commerce.
Responsabilidades
- Desenvolvimento Core: Projetar, desenvolver e evoluir o core da plataforma Killbill, criando customizações e plugins para garantir performance, escalabilidade e estabilidade, utilizando primariamente Java.
- Integrações de Pagamento: Criar e manter plugins de pagamento e APIs de integração em Node.js/TypeScript, conectando o Killbill a gateways, sistemas financeiros e plataformas de e-commerce.
- Arquitetura e Soluções: Desenhar e implementar soluções de Billing que suportem regras fiscais e contábeis complexas, faturamento, e o processo completo de cobrança.
- DevOps e Infraestrutura: Atuar na manutenção e otimização do ambiente em nuvem, utilizando conhecimentos de conteinerização (Docker e Kubernetes) em infraestruturas como AWS e/ou OCI.
- Observabilidade: Implementar e manter ferramentas de monitoramento e tracking, utilizando Datadog, ClickHouse e Vector, para garantir a saúde do sistema e investigar falhas técnicas profundas em produção.
- APIs e Dados: Criar APIs REST robustas e performáticas, gerenciando a comunicação e a persistência de dados em diferentes estruturas (tanto bancos de dados SQL quanto NoSQL).
- Colaboração de Negócio: Traduzir requisitos de negócio (principalmente relacionados a e-commerce, integração com ERP e regras fiscais/contábeis) em soluções técnicas sustentáveis, trabalhando em metodologia ágil.
Requisitos
- Experiência em Billing: Experiência profissional sólida e comprovada com algum sistema de Billing/Faturamento (ex: Killbill, Oracle BRM, Amdocs One, Kenan Arbor, Vindicia, Zuora).
- Proficiência em Linguagens: Domínio absoluto em desenvolvimento Backend utilizando Java e forte experiência com Node.js (preferencialmente com TypeScript).
- Arquitetura: Conhecimento aprofundado em arquitetura de software, design patterns e design de APIs REST.
- Bancos de Dados: Experiência prática com modelagem e otimização de consultas em sistemas SQL (ex: MySQL, PostgreSQL) e NoSQL.
- Conteinerização: Experiência com Docker e orquestração de containers (Kubernetes - K8s).
- Negócio de Faturamento: Conhecimento sobre os processos de faturamento, cobrança, regras fiscais e contábeis.
- Comunicação: Fluência em Português, e conhecimento básico de Inglês e Espanhol para leitura de documentação técnica e colaboração com equipes internacionais.
Diferenciais
- Experiência direta com customização ou desenvolvimento de plugins para o Killbill.
- Vivência com serviços de Cloud da AWS e/ou Oracle Cloud Infrastructure (OCI).
- Experiência com ferramentas de log e rastreamento (ClickHouse, Vector, Datadog).
- Vivência em ambientes de e-commerce e projetos de integração com ERP.
Habilidades Comportamentais
- Proatividade e autonomia para investigar e resolver problemas técnicos complexos e críticos (troubleshooting avançado).
- Excelente comunicação e colaboração com diferentes perfis de equipe e stakeholders (Produto, Finanças, Operações).
- Organização, atenção aos detalhes e resiliência para trabalhar em ambientes de missão crítica.
- Valorizamos pessoas protagonistas, curiosas e comprometidas com a excelência técnica.
- Buscamos quem aprende rápido, compartilha conhecimento e se adapta bem a mudanças e metodologias ágeis.
- Aqui, você terá espaço para crescer, inovar e fazer a diferença no coração financeiro da empresa.
Informações da Vaga
- Modelo híbrido
- Contratação PJ.
Benefícios
- Ausência remunerada de 30 dias.
- Plano de saúde conveniado (desconto no valor total e redução de carências).
- Wellhub (Gympass), Totalpass ou similar.
- Programa de bem-estar.
- Serviço de telemedicina.
- Clubes de benefícios.
- Day-off de aniversário.
Localização | Modelo de contratação | Modelo de trabalho |
---|---|---|
São Paulo, SP, BR | Autônomo PJ | Híbrido |